src/s/e/seal-0.4.0-rc2/seal/lib/aligner/bwa/bwa_mapping.py   seal(Download)
  def get_base_qualities(self):
    if not hasattr(self, '__base_qualities'):
      if self.__read.qual:
        # BWA keeps base quality is in ASCII-33
        it = xrange(self.__read.full_len-1,-1,-1) if self.is_on_reverse() else xrange(self.__read.full_len)
  def get_seq_5(self):
    if not hasattr(self, "__seq5"):
      if self.is_on_reverse():
        # The sequence self.__read.get_rseq()[::-1] is shifted by one position.  The way to get
        # the correct reverse complement sequence is to build it from seq, which is exactly